The health department has logged five inspections at Garcia's Market Y Carniceria, the earliest from 2024. Inspectors last stopped by on Jan 26, 2026. A low risk rating suggests inspectors haven't found much to be concerned about lately.

Violation counts have been trending down, averaging around zero violations across recent inspections versus roughly two violations before.

“Certified food protection manager” accounts for the largest share of issues, appearing two times across the record.

Among Phoenix restaurants, the typical score is 97; Garcia's Market Y Carniceria is comfortably above that bar. The file should reassure diners considering a visit.

Equipment or utensils not clean (corrected on site)
Inspector notes: Observed meat table slicer with an accumulation of organic dried food debris on blade and crevices. Person in charge (PIC) states they had not used meat slicer since Monday, 3 days before inspection. Explained to PIC that all food-contact surfaces must be cleaned to sight and touch. PIC relocated all food-contact surfaces to warewashing area to be washed, rinsed, and sanitized at the time of inspection. Reviewed cleaning procedures with PIC
4-601.11(A)
